LOCATION

Rackham Drive sits nestled within a tranquil cul de sac just off Riddy Lane, a coveted area in the northern region of Luton. Developed in the mid-1990s, this enclave offers a serene atmosphere sought after by many. Within walking distance, residents enjoy easy access to various local amenities, including a convenient parade of shops, nearby bus stops, doctors & pharmacy. The strategic location places Junction 10 of the M1 motorway, Luton ThamesLink train station & London Luton airport within a short drive, ensuring seamless connectivity. Families are drawn to the area for its proximity to reputable educational institutions, with Icknield Primary & Icknield High School both situated within walking distance, enhancing the appeal of this vibrant community.
